How to Make Banana Cake With Caramel Frosting
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and lightly flour a 9x13 inch baking pan.
- Cream together 1 cup (2 sticks) softened margarine, 1 ¾ cups granulated sugar, and 2 large eggs until light and fluffy.
- Mash 3 ripe bananas and stir them into the creamed mixture along with ½ cup milk.
- In a separate bowl, whisk together 2 cups all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on baking soda, and ½ teaspoon salt.
-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ined. Do not overmix.
- Pour batter into the prepared pan and bake for 45-55 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Let the cake cool completely in the pan before frosting.
- **Prepare the Salted Caramel Frosting:** In a medium saucepan, combine ½ cup (1 stick) butter, 1 cup packed brown sugar, and ¼ cup milk.
- Bring the mixture to a boil over medium heat, stirring constantly, for 2 minutes.
- Remove from heat and let cool slightly.
- Gradually beat in 2 cups powdered sugar until smooth and creamy. Stir in a pinch of sea salt.
- Once the cake is completely cool, frost generously with the salted caramel frosting.
